Subject: Re: [PATCH] mtd: nftl: use %*ph to print small buffer

> Use %*ph format to print small buffer as hex string.

> drivers/mtd/nftlmount.c | 3 +--
>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 2 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/mtd/nftlmount.c b/drivers/mtd/nftlmount.c
> index 184c8fbfe465..a8bdc1455b50 100644
> --- a/drivers/mtd/nftlmount.c
> +++ b/drivers/mtd/nftlmount.c
> @@ -122,8 +122,7 @@ static int find_boot_record(struct NFTLrecord *nftl)
> if (memcmp(buf, "ANAND", 6)) {
> printk(KERN_NOTICE "ANAND header found at 0x%x in mtd%d, but went away on reread!\n",
> block * nftl->EraseSize, nftl->mbd.mtd->index);
> - printk(KERN_NOTICE "New data are: %02x %02x %02x %02x %02x %02x\n",
> - buf[0], buf[1], buf[2], buf[3], buf[4], buf[5]);
> + printk(KERN_NOTICE "New data are: %6ph\n", buf);
> continue;
> }
> #endif
